Understanding the Factors Influencing Car Prices in Argentina
Okay, let's dive into what makes the precio de autos 0 km en Argentina tick. Several factors come into play, and understanding these will give you a serious edge when you start shopping around. Buckle up!
Taxes, Taxes, and More Taxes!
Yep, you guessed it. Taxes have a HUGE impact on car prices in Argentina. We're talking about a complex web of national, provincial, and municipal taxes, including VAT (IVA), internal taxes, and more. These can significantly inflate the final price you pay at the dealership. The specific tax burden can vary depending on the origin of the car (imported vs. locally manufactured) and the province where you make the purchase.
Exchange Rate Fluctuations
Argentina's economy is known for its, shall we say, dynamic exchange rates. The value of the Argentine Peso (ARS) against the US dollar (USD) can fluctuate quite a bit, and since many car components are imported or priced in USD, these fluctuations directly affect the precios de autos 0km. When the Peso weakens, imported cars become more expensive, and even locally manufactured cars can see price increases due to imported parts.
Import Restrictions and Trade Policies
The Argentine government sometimes implements import restrictions or changes to trade policies to protect local industries or manage the country's trade balance. These measures can limit the supply of certain car models, leading to higher prices due to increased demand and limited availability. Keep an eye on any policy changes that might affect the car market.
Inflation
Inflation is a significant factor in Argentina's economy, and it has a direct impact on just about everything, including car prices. As the cost of production, transportation, and labor increases due to inflation, car manufacturers and dealerships pass these costs on to consumers. This means that the precio de un auto 0km can increase steadily over time, even for the same model.

Popular 0 km Car Models and Their Approximate Prices
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and look at some popular 0 km car models in Argentina and their approximate prices. Keep in mind that these are just estimates, and the actual prices may vary depending on the dealership, location, and any applicable promotions.
Fiat Cronos
The Fiat Cronos is a popular sedan known for its spacious interior and fuel efficiency. It's a locally manufactured model, which can sometimes make it a bit more affordable than imported options. The precio Fiat Cronos 0km typically starts around ARS 8,000,000 for the base model and can go up to ARS 11,000,000 or more for higher trim levels with more features. This car is considered a great value for its price point, offering a comfortable ride and decent performance for everyday use.
Volkswagen Gol Trend
The Volkswagen Gol Trend has long been a favorite in Argentina, known for its reliability and affordability. While production has ceased, there are still some 0km units available. Expect to pay around ARS 7,500,000 to ARS 9,500,000 depending on the trim and options. Its compact size makes it perfect for navigating city streets, and its reputation for durability makes it a solid choice for budget-conscious buyers.
Renault Sandero
The Renault Sandero is another popular hatchback that offers a good balance of space, features, and price. The precio Renault Sandero 0km generally ranges from ARS 7,800,000 to ARS 10,000,000, depending on the version. It's known for its comfortable ride and decent fuel economy, making it a practical choice for families and individuals alike.
Toyota Corolla
For those looking for a more premium option, the Toyota Corolla is a well-regarded sedan known for its reliability, comfort, and resale value. The precio Toyota Corolla 0km usually starts around ARS 12,000,000 and can go up to ARS 16,000,000 or more for the hybrid versions or higher trim levels. While it's more expensive than some of the other models on this list, the Corolla offers a refined driving experience and a reputation for longevity that many buyers find appealing.
Chevrolet Onix
The Chevrolet Onix is a stylish and modern hatchback that has gained popularity in recent years. The precio Chevrolet Onix 0km typically falls in the range of ARS 8,500,000 to ARS 11,500,000, depending on the trim level and options. It offers a good blend of features, including a user-friendly infotainment system and available safety technologies, making it an attractive option for younger buyers or those looking for a tech-savvy car.
Important Note: These prices are approximate and can change rapidly due to inflation and exchange rate fluctuations. Always check with local dealerships for the most up-to-date pricing information.
Tips for Finding the Best Deals on 0 km Cars
Okay, you've got a good understanding of the factors influencing prices and some popular models to consider. Now, let's talk about how to snag the best possible deal on your 0 km car. Here are some tips to keep in mind:
Shop Around and Compare Prices
This might seem obvious, but it's worth emphasizing: Don't settle for the first price you're quoted. Visit multiple dealerships, both in person and online, to compare prices and see what different incentives they're offering. You might be surprised at the variations you find.
Negotiate, Negotiate, Negotiate!
Don't be afraid to haggle! Car prices are often negotiable, especially if you're a savvy negotiator. Do your research ahead of time to know what a fair price is for the model you're interested in, and be prepared to walk away if the dealer isn't willing to meet your price. Remember, they want to make a sale just as much as you want to buy a car.
Consider Financing Options Carefully
If you're planning to finance your car purchase, carefully compare the interest rates and terms offered by different lenders. Dealerships often have their own financing arms, but it's always a good idea to shop around and see if you can get a better rate from a bank or credit union. Be sure to factor in the total cost of the loan, including interest and fees, when making your decision.
Look for Special Promotions and Incentives
Keep an eye out for special promotions, discounts, and incentives offered by manufacturers or dealerships. These can include cash rebates, low-interest financing, or bundled packages with extra features. These promotions can change frequently, so it's worth checking back regularly to see what's available.
Be Flexible with Your Preferences
If you're willing to be flexible with your color, trim level, or optional features, you might be able to find a better deal. Dealerships are often more willing to offer discounts on cars that have been sitting on the lot for a while, so consider models that might not be the most popular or in-demand.
Time Your Purchase Strategically
The time of year can also influence car prices. Dealerships are often eager to meet sales quotas at the end of the month, quarter, or year, so you might be able to negotiate a better deal during these periods. Additionally, new models typically come out in the fall, so dealerships might be looking to clear out older inventory to make room for the new cars.
